The Montreal Protocol is significant as it is an agreement of 191 countries aimed at addressing ozone depletion through international cooperation. It has effectively reduced the use of ozone-depleting substances, although not all have been completely banned. The Protocol requires governmental action, demonstrating the importance of policy in tackling environmental issues.
